|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 456 人关注过本帖
标题:为什么总是提示我用户已经存在呢?(在库中没有)
只看楼主 加入收藏
zmyzzz
Rank: 1
等 级:新手上路
帖 子:145
专家分:0
注 册:2005-9-21
收藏
 问题点数:0 回复次数:3 
为什么总是提示我用户已经存在呢?(在库中没有)
<%@LANGUAGE="VBSCRIPT" CODEPAGE="936"%> <% option explicit dim conn,db,sql,username,userphone dim rs db="mdb/aaaa.mdb" Set conn = Server.CreateObject("ADODB.Connection") conn.open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& Server.MapPath(db) sql="select *from aaaaa" Set rs = Server.CreateObject("ADODB.RecordSet") rs.open sql,conn,1,1 username=request.form("textname") userphone=request.form("textphone") sql="select * from aaaaa where name=username" if not rs.eof then '表示有记录 response.write "该用户已经存在" else sql="insert into aaaaa (name,phone) values ('"&username&"','"&userphone&"')" conn.Execute(sql) response.write "用户:"&username&"添加成功!" end if rs.close conn.close set conn=nothing %> 就第一次添加成功了,再添加的时候就提示我用户已经存在了....这是怎么回事啊???
搜索更多相关主题的帖子: 用户 提示 
2005-09-22 17:23
islet
Rank: 12Rank: 12Rank: 12
等 级:贵宾
威 望:89
帖 子:6548
专家分:0
注 册:2005-1-28
收藏
得分:0 
[QUOTE]sql="select * from aaaaa where name=username"[/QUOTE] sql="select * from aaaaa where name='"&username&"'"
2005-09-22 17:29
islet
Rank: 12Rank: 12Rank: 12
等 级:贵宾
威 望:89
帖 子:6548
专家分:0
注 册:2005-1-28
收藏
得分:0 
sql="select * from aaaaa where name='"&username&"'" rs.open sql,conn,1,1'这句话放在这里!不要放在上面 你查所有的当然会not eof 了
2005-09-22 17:31
zmyzzz
Rank: 1
等 级:新手上路
帖 子:145
专家分:0
注 册:2005-9-21
收藏
得分:0 
哦.....我明白了,已经可以了..谢谢大家

吾尝终日而思之,不如须臾之所学也
2005-09-23 09:02
快速回复:为什么总是提示我用户已经存在呢?(在库中没有)
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.025756 second(s), 8 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ved